This is an Airstream hotel located in the Bay Area called AutoCamp.

The community was started with the help of a Kickstarter campaign which raised $121,831.

Highlights

  • 24 luxury Airstream trailers
  • 10 luxury tents
  • Clubhouse designed by Dan Weber Architecture
  • Interiors by Geremia Design
  • Airstream nightly rates start at $225/night
  • Luxury tents start at $139/night
  • Location is surrounded by Northern California’s redwoods
